Transaction ef54e0c8628c9fc5a6e9f8ba52a58e2986a17362a860e9aa71a44e6190fa0c8f
1 Input
1 Output
-
ef54e0c8628c9fc5a6e9f8ba52a58e2986a17362a860e9aa71a44e6190fa0c8f:0
- value
- 17898575
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7af92e751bd382280167b3dfc84f705a245cc66f OP_EQUAL
- address
- 3CuEsNxfjUgTbbsqHf5kbNBy81ujbFaz99